A restful, relaxing practice starting with Alternate Nostril Breathing, then a few restorative poses done on both sides to support the ability to bend without breaking. We'll practice Reclined twist, Open Bridge / Pelvic Float and Supta Padangusthasana. You'll need a bolster, block and belt.
